    Maintain Your Vehicle’s Suspension System to Ensure Comfort, Safety, and Prolonged Performance

    The suspension system of a vehicle is crucial for ensuring a smooth and comfortable ride by absorbing the bumps and dips on the road. It consists of several components, including shock absorbers, struts, coil springs, leaf springs, and tires. These parts work together to reduce the impact of road imperfections, providing stability, comfort, and overall safety for the driver and passengers. Additionally, the suspension system helps maintain the longevity of the vehicle by preventing excessive wear on other components, such as the tires and steering system.

    While professional maintenance is vital for the suspension system, there are some simple maintenance steps you can take at home to keep it in good condition. One of the most important tasks is to regularly check the tire pressure. Since the tires are the only components in direct contact with the road, it’s essential to ensure they are inflated to the manufacturer’s recommended levels. This helps the suspension system function properly, reducing the impact of road bumps and maintaining overall ride quality. A quick check with a reliable tire gauge can help you maintain optimal tire pressure.

    Another essential aspect of suspension system care is checking the condition of the tires, particularly the tread depth. Healthy tires ensure better road grip and, by extension, a more effective suspension. Treadwear can often indicate problems with the suspension or alignment. Using simple methods like the penny test, you can check if the tread depth is still within the recommended levels. If you notice uneven wear, it’s important to have your suspension or alignment professionally checked to avoid further damage.

    Common signs that your suspension system may need repair include a rough ride, unusual bouncing or rocking when braking, or visible leaks from your shocks or struts. Other symptoms, such as your vehicle sitting lower to the ground or tires showing uneven wear, can also indicate suspension problems. If any of these issues arise, it’s crucial to have your vehicle inspected by a professional technician to diagnose and replace worn components. This ensures that your suspension system continues to function properly and keeps the vehicle safe to drive.
